DECYL METHYL ETHER
Description
Decyl Methyl Ether, also known as Methyl Decyl Ether or C10-C12 Alkyl Ethers, is a versatile synthetic ingredient used in various skincare and haircare formulations. This clear, colorless liquid functions primarily as an emollient and solvent, offering multiple benefits to cosmetic products.
In skincare applications, Decyl Methyl Ether acts as a lightweight, non-greasy emollient, helping to soften and smooth the skin without leaving a heavy residue. It enhances the spreadability of formulations, improving the overall texture and feel of products. This ingredient also serves as an effective solvent, aiding in the dissolution of other components and ensuring a uniform distribution of active ingredients throughout the product.
Decyl Methyl Ether's low surface tension allows it to penetrate the skin's surface easily, potentially enhancing the delivery of other beneficial ingredients. In haircare formulations, it can help improve the manageability and smoothness of hair strands. Its volatile nature means it evaporates quickly, leaving behind a dry, non-tacky finish.
While generally considered safe for cosmetic use, as with any ingredient, individuals with sensitive skin should perform a patch test before widespread application.
